I rented out a confirmed reservation thru one of the agencies. It went smoothly and I'd do it again if I had to. My resevation was more than 30 days away but it was made using banked points that would expire before I could use them if I canceld (it was a newly purchased resale contract).

I was a little uncomfortable about giving the agency direct access to my DVC account (username and password). They took care of making all of the name changes on the reservation when a renter was found. Obviously, this takes a great deal of trust and I don't recommended it for everyone. I changed my password immediately after the reservation was rented.

You will also have to accept that you are not going to get the going rate for other rentals. You will have to take less in order to attract last minute bargain hunters. If you list it on your own on the Rent/Trade board, you can expect to field a lot of lowball offers.

In all honesty, if you believe that you could make a trip later in 2018, you may be better off cancelling and letting the points go into holding. You will have almost an entire year to make use of the points before they expire and if you eventually decide that you can't travel in 2018, you can list your points with an agency at that time.
